Output 81dbc45327bd7b3738936d20437be7184b73b10e8604d1e89910207f90236561:8

value
52097337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d4117a090d4280414b1f479ded811368a560f1a OP_EQUAL
address
34MhVoH4wDXKPzaB5T6qjhsv3Auwz1zs7T
transaction
81dbc45327bd7b3738936d20437be7184b73b10e8604d1e89910207f90236561
spent
true